The staff here was friendly and helpful. My room was comfortable but one pillowcase was dirty, and there was no hair dryer in the room. However, there was one available at the front desk. A refrigerator in the room would have been nice as well. The continental breakfast was limited (cereal, waffles, and donuts), but pretty expected. My main complaint was the price of room - almost $100 per night, which was way overpriced in my opinion.

This is a great motel to stay at; very clean, friendly staff, good value. A pleasant drive of only 50mi will take you to the North entrance of Yellowstone NP. My only "complaint" is that you no longer earn "Choice Privileges" points at the Econo Lodge.

We were passing through Livingston and were looking for an economical place to spend the night, as we had an early flight out of Bozeman the following morning. Based on other TripAdvisor reviews, we chose the Econo Lodge and we more than happy w/ our stay there. The staff was very helpful and friendly. When we asked about suggestions for local restaurants they had a list already prepared and pointed us to some of their favorites. It was clean and quiet, which was all we were really looking for. Given the same situation, I would definitely stay there again.
PS - If you're looking for a really great burger and fries, try The Stockman in downtown Livingston. Best burger I ever had!

Cannot praise this place highly enough, it is one of the best motels/hotels (of over 30) I have stayed in whilst travelling in the USA over the past couple of months. Staff were extremely friendly and accommodating and owners obviously take a pride in running a superb inn - when we found that the only room still available had no fridge, they let us store our cold stuff in their fridge overnight. Whole place was very clean and modern, nice pool and free (if rather slow) Internet access in lobby.

Breakfast was varied with bread/toast, cereals, tea/coffee ("real" milk available, much appreciated by we English tea-drinkers, who cannot stomach putting creamer in tea!) - much better quality than the meagre microscopic tasteless donuts/pastries I have endured in some Econo Lodges.

All round, this must be the best place to stay in Livingston and for miles around.

This place was new looking, clean, and in great condition. The staff was very helpful. The free breakfast was good - a good selection of muffins, toast, jam, cereal, coffee, juices, fruit. The staff was very friendly and helpful.

Note: This is an EconoLodge, so it wasn't fancy. I give it 5/5 not for any amazing extra features, but because it delivered all the basics so very well.

On our seven night trip through BC, Alberta, Montana, and Yellowstone, this was about the cheapest place we stayed and about the best place we stayed (excluding Yellowstone Lodge Cabins).

Convenient location, right next to the I-5. Quiet. Thre's not too much excitment & fun activities at the hotel, but it is a great place if you're just passing through or exploring the surrounding areas.
